Today, September 22, 2022, at 9:03 pm EST in the Northern Hemisphere, marks the official first day of autumn. The fall season ushers in cooler temperatures and beautiful foliage. If you are looking for ways to celebrate the autumn equinox, check out the following for inspiration.

Get Outdoors
Enjoying nature is the best way to celebrate the autumn equinox. Spend as much time as possible outdoors. Enjoy the fresh air.
- Go on a hike.
- Go stargazing.
- Grab your camera and go on a nature walk.
- Gather pinecones, acorns, twigs, leaves, rocks, and other nature items for crafts.
- Have a picnic in the park.
- Read a book while sitting under your favorite tree.
- Mediate outdoors.

Create a Feast
The autumn season is historically a time to harvest crops. Make a meal or dessert with freshly harvested fruits and vegetables.
- Make a stew in your crock pot. The smell will fill the entire house.
- Bake an apple or pumpkin pie.
- Make fresh soup from squash, pumpkin, or potatoes.
- Eat fruit including apples, pears, and berries.
- Make zucchini bread.
- Create a salad from fall harvest vegetables
- Eat corn on the cob or fresh carrots.
